Two Muted-Tone, Exposed-Brick Pads for Young Families

Young families and contemporary interiors are not always the best of friends. Kids mean playtime – cooking, drawing, running around – and invariably, a mess that just won’t fit with your new white couch. Avoid crayoned white walls and large stains on your shagpile by using easy-to-clean, industrial materials - like these two family homes in the Ukraine and Belarus. Dreamy mushrooms and muted beiges meet black and white, exposed brick and subtle pastels in spaces that look luxurious – and remain that way. A blue couch here, and teal bathroom tiling there, allow interesting colour combinations that are near impossible to ruin. Flick through for two family-friendly designs to inspire your interior.
